Script Indicador de Pronóstico de Regresión Lineal

Script Indicador de Pronóstico de Regresión Lineal

El indicador de Pronóstico de Regresión Lineal es una herramienta poderosa utilizada en el análisis técnico para predecir la dirección futura de los precios basándose en datos históricos. Este script, disponible en la plataforma de IQ Option, permite a los traders visualizar una línea de tendencia basada en la regresión lineal, ayudándolos a tomar decisiones informadas sobre sus operaciones.

Script del Indicador de Pronóstico de Regresión Lineal

A continuación, se muestra el script del indicador de Pronóstico de Regresión Lineal. Explicaremos cada componente del script y cómo contribuye al funcionamiento del indicador.

luaCopiar códigoinstrument { name = "Linear Regression Forecast", overlay = true }

period = input (14, "front.period", input.integer, 2)
source = input (1, "front.ind.source", input.string_selection, inputs.titles_overlay)

input_group {
    "front.ind.dpo.generalline",
    color = input { default = "#FF6C58", type = input.color },
    width = input { default = 1, type = input.line_width}
}

local sourceSeries = inputs [source]

plot (linreg (sourceSeries, period, 0), "Forecast", color, width)

Componentes del Indicador

  1. Configuración del Período:
    • period = input (14, "front.period", input.integer, 2): Permite al usuario definir el período para la regresión lineal. El valor predeterminado es 14, pero se puede ajustar según las preferencias del trader.
  2. Selección de Fuente de Datos:
    • source = input (1, "front.ind.source", input.string_selection, inputs.titles_overlay): Permite seleccionar la fuente de datos para el cálculo, como el precio de cierre, apertura, máximo, mínimo, etc.
  3. Configuración de la Línea de Pronóstico:
    • input_group { "front.ind.dpo.generalline", color = input { default = "#FF6C58", type = input.color }, width = input { default = 1, type = input.line_width}}: Permite personalizar el color y el grosor de la línea de pronóstico que se trazará en el gráfico.
  4. Cálculo de la Regresión Lineal:
    • local sourceSeries = inputs [source]: Obtiene los datos de la fuente seleccionada.
    • plot (linreg (sourceSeries, period, 0), "Forecast", color, width): Calcula la línea de regresión lineal utilizando los datos de la fuente seleccionada y el período definido, y la traza en el gráfico con las configuraciones especificadas.

Interpretación del Indicador de Pronóstico de Regresión Lineal

El indicador de Pronóstico de Regresión Lineal proporciona una línea de tendencia que predice el movimiento futuro de los precios basado en datos históricos. Aquí hay algunas formas en las que los traders pueden interpretar y utilizar este indicador:

  1. Identificación de Tendencias:
    • Una pendiente ascendente en la línea de regresión sugiere una tendencia alcista, mientras que una pendiente descendente indica una tendencia bajista.
  2. Detección de Cambios en la Tendencia:
    • Los cambios en la pendiente de la línea de regresión pueden señalar posibles cambios en la dirección de la tendencia. Por ejemplo, si una línea de regresión que estaba subiendo comienza a aplanarse o a descender, podría indicar un cambio de una tendencia alcista a una bajista.
  3. Confirmación de Niveles de Soporte y Resistencia:
    • La línea de regresión puede actuar como un nivel dinámico de soporte o resistencia. Los precios que rebotan en la línea de regresión pueden confirmar la validez de estos niveles.

Ventajas del Indicador de Pronóstico de Regresión Lineal

  • Simplicidad: El indicador es fácil de interpretar y usar, adecuado para traders de todos los niveles de experiencia.
  • Versatilidad: Puede aplicarse en cualquier marco temporal y en cualquier mercado financiero.
  • Predicción Basada en Datos: Utiliza datos históricos para proporcionar una predicción objetiva de la dirección del precio.

Conclusión

El indicador de Pronóstico de Regresión Lineal es una herramienta valiosa para cualquier trader que busque basar sus decisiones en análisis técnicos sólidos. Al proporcionar una línea de tendencia basada en datos históricos, este indicador puede ayudar a identificar tendencias, detectar cambios y confirmar niveles de soporte y resistencia. Con su simplicidad y versatilidad, es una excelente adición a cualquier estrategia de trading.

Script Completo

instrument { name = "Linear Regression Forecast", overlay = true }

period = input (14,"front.period", input.integer, 2)
source = input (1, "front.ind.source", input.string_selection, inputs.titles_overlay)

input_group {
"front.ind.dpo.generalline",
color = input { default = "#FF6C58", type = input.color },
width = input { default = 1, type = input.line_width}
}

local sourceSeries = inputs [source]

plot (linreg (sourceSeries, period, 0), "Forecast", color, width)
Carrito de compra
Scroll al inicio
Telegram